    Pre-Production Design Process at Factory Design:
    Factory Design follows a structured approach towards pre-production design, which involves close collaboration with their clients. The process can be summarized in the following six steps:

    1. Initial Consultation: The first step involves understanding the client′s requirements, goals, and challenges. A team of experienced consultants conducts an in-depth analysis of the client′s current factory layout, process flow, and production targets.

    2. Conceptual Design: Based on the initial consultation, Factory Design creates a conceptual design that outlines the proposed changes in the layout, equipment, and processes. This is done using advanced simulation tools to provide a virtual walkthrough of the proposed design.

    3. Detailed Design: Once the client approves the conceptual design, the team works on creating a detailed design that includes engineering drawings, specifications, and cost estimates.

    4. Implementation Planning: In this phase, Factory Design works closely with the client to develop a detailed implementation plan that outlines the timeline, resources, and potential risks.

    5. Implementation: The implementation phase involves the actual execution of the detailed design. The team oversees the procurement, installation, and commissioning of the new equipment and processes.

    6. Follow-up and Review: After the implementation, Factory Design conducts a follow-up review to assess the effectiveness of the design and address any issues that may have arisen during the implementation process.

    Implementation Challenges:
    Despite the overall positive impact of pre-production design work, Factory Design faces several challenges during the implementation phase. Some key challenges observed include:

    1. Availability of Resources: The implementation of detailed designs requires the procurement of new equipment and processes. This can be a challenge as some clients may face restrictions in terms of budget or suppliers may have limited availability.
    2. Resistance to Change: Implementing a new design often requires changes in the current factory layout and processes, which can be met with resistance from the workers. This can lead to delays and disruptions during implementation.
    3. Unforeseen Issues: Despite thorough planning, unexpected issues may arise during the implementation process, which can cause delays and affect the success of the project.
